Accenture is one of the largest professional-services firms in the world, hiring across Strategy & Consulting, Technology, Song, and Operations. The process is competency-based and video-first — for most roles the earliest real hurdle is a recorded digital interview, not a live conversation.

The Accenture interview process — stage by stage

📝
Online application + assessments

Application, then online assessments — typically situational judgement plus numerical/logical reasoning, and for tech roles a coding or skills test. These screen before any interview.

🎥
Accenture Digital Interview (recorded)

A pre-recorded, one-way video interview: you answer set behavioral and motivational questions on camera against a timer, with no live interviewer. This is where most candidates are filtered.

🧩
Assessment / Job Simulation

A case study, group exercise, or immersive "Job Simulation" for consulting and analyst roles — testing structured problem-solving and how you work with others.

🏢
Final interview

A live interview (virtual or on-site) with a manager or senior leader, covering fit, motivation, and role-specific depth. Expect "why Accenture" and "why consulting/technology".

How to prepare for the Accenture interview

1
Treat the digital interview as the real interview

The recorded video screen — not the final round — is where most candidates fall. Practise answering to a timer on webcam: look into the lens, structure with STAR, and finish inside the time limit.

2
Know Accenture's core values and "360° value"

Accenture talks about client value, inclusion & diversity, and responsible business. Weave genuine examples that reflect these — generic answers read as un-researched.

3
Show technology curiosity

Even for non-technical roles, Accenture wants people energised by AI, cloud, and transformation. Reference a specific trend or an Accenture client story you find interesting.

4
Quantify impact, not activity

Accenture interviewers reward outcomes: time saved, revenue influenced, users affected. Put a number on your stories wherever you honestly can.

What a strong Accenture answer looks like

A worked STAR answer to a real Accenture-style question, showing how to structure situation, task, action, and result.

Question

Tell me about a time you worked in a team to deliver something under pressure.

Situation

During a university consulting project, our four-person team was building a go-to-market plan for a fintech startup, and two weeks in a member dropped out, leaving us short with the client presentation unchanged.

Task

As the informal lead I had to re-plan the workload and still deliver a credible, data-backed recommendation on the original timeline.

Action

I re-scoped the analysis to the two questions the client actually cared about, split ownership by strength, set a daily 15-minute check-in, and personally took the financial model so the others could focus on research and the deck. I also flagged the risk to the client early and reset expectations on scope, not deadline.

Result

We delivered on time; the client adopted our pricing recommendation and asked the university to run two further projects. I learned that cutting scope deliberately beats missing a deadline quietly.

Frequently asked questions

What is the Accenture digital interview?

The Accenture digital interview is a pre-recorded, one-way video screen used early in the process for most graduate and experienced roles. You are shown a set question, given a short time to prepare, then record your video answer against a timer — there is no live interviewer. Answers are assessed for competencies, motivation, and fit before you reach a live round.

Does Accenture use HireVue or an online assessment?

Yes. Accenture uses recorded video interviews (HireVue-style) and online assessments — situational judgement, numerical/logical reasoning, and for technology roles a coding or skills test — as early filters. Treat the assessments as seriously as the interview itself.

Is the Accenture interview recorded (one-way) or live?

The first interview is typically recorded and one-way — you answer on camera with no interviewer present. Later stages (the assessment/Job Simulation and the final interview) are live, virtual or on-site. Practising on webcam to a timer is the best way to get comfortable with the recorded format.

What questions does the Accenture video interview ask?

Expect competency and motivational questions: teamwork under pressure, using technology or data to solve a problem, adapting to change, influencing stakeholders, and "why Accenture". Prepare 5–7 STAR stories you can deliver in under two minutes each.

How long is the Accenture recruitment process?

Typically 3–6 weeks: application → online assessments → digital (recorded) interview → assessment/Job Simulation → final interview → offer. Graduate schemes run on fixed intake timelines, so apply early in the cycle.
